The NRG Island system is designed for quick and easy installation, directly on the banks of reservoirs, quarries and dams. Thanks to its modular structure, the floating units are pre-assembled on the ground and then connected horizontally and vertically, allowing the floating photovoltaic system to be built efficiently and safely.

NRG Island systems offer significant advantages over other floating photovoltaic systems in the market.  The innovative design of our floats and frames allows for a quick and easy assembly, and adapts to any type of photovoltaic panel. The proximity to the water surface and increase in reflected light improves energy efficiency, allowing for an increase of the energy production up to 15% more than any  similar system installed on land.

Efficiency, innovation and sustainability

Our systems, in addition to having a higher efficiency in energy production, reduces the evaporation rate of water by up to 90%.
Furthermore, by not occupying the space under the panels, we can promote air circulation under the modules, preserving adequate oxygenation of the water.
To build our systems we use only new materials, which do not release pollutants into the water. This allows us to install in complete safety even on drinking water basins or habitats populated by flora and fauna.

Safety, stability and resistance

The flat surface of our floating installations guarantees an extremely stable and safe platform, allowing you to walk easily on the walkways formed by continuous rows of floats, without wasting spaces. This design makes maintenance operations simple and safe. In addition to, the high quality of the materials, the compactness of the structure gives the island a greater resistance even to the most extreme weather conditions, offering high wind resistance. Excellent stability is guaranteed by a patented anchoring system and a customized docking, sized and measured for each specific installation requirement.

The advantages of water systems

  • Water saving: in the areas covered by the systems (the coverage is however partial) the evaporation of the water underneath is reduced by up to 90%.
 
  • We redevelop abandoned areas: floating plants do not consume land by their nature, except for the components aimed at connecting to the general electrical network. Furthermore, they do not involve the construction of buildings and infrastructures that are difficult to decommission in the event of restoration of the pre-existing environmental state.

Floating photovoltaic performance

 

  • Increased efficiency: floating solar panels offer better performance compared to ground-based systems, where high summer temperatures, especially near the ground, reduces both the efficiency and lifespan of the modules. For the same size, a floating PV system can generate up to 15% more electricity than one installed on land.
  • Abandoned areas, salt water and fresh water reservoirsNRG Island systems can be installed anywhere, easily adapting even to former abandoned quarries and reservoirs. This solution not only, enhances spaces that are normally unused, but also allows for effective control, preventing degradation and the risk of them becoming illegal landfills.

  • Reduced maintenance: the panels installed on the floating NRG Island system require significantly less maintenance than ground or roof-mounted photovoltaic systems. In addition, there is no need to cut vegetation, which is typically required by traditional PV systems, hence initial site preparation is minimized, as no ground leveling work is required. All this while ensuring the same operational efficiency as a traditional system.
